Hi guys, i just changed my spark plug, cleaned the TB and my MAF sensor. when i put everything back my idel is very high at 1500 rpm, where it used to be below 1000. (around 700) i did touch the throttle cable bolts (trying taking off the TB) what could be the problem? what should i do? thanks!!
My .02 would be to reset the ECU or just drive the car like normal for a week. Let the comp adjust to the new way the motor runs cause of the changes you made (new plugs, TB and MAF, etc..) It should smooth itself out.

so i reset the ECU and drove around for about 5 mins, everything went back to normal!! Thank you sooo much guys. gave me a heart attack there. my old plugs had 120k miles on them... they look pretty beat up too. but surprisingly i dont feel much of a difference. i think it's more smooth.. but my car has always been smooth anyways. but thank you for your help again!!! much appreciated!
